Titusville, PA Radon Mitigation and Testing
Positioned in Crawford County in northwestern Pennsylvania, Titusville (zip code 16354) sits in a region where glacial deposits over sedimentary bedrock create moderate radon potential. Testing data for this community is currently limited, though Pennsylvania's geological diversity means radon levels can vary significantly even within small areas. Individual home testing is recommended for all residents.

Titusville Radon Facts
Key details about the radon risk profile for Titusville and the 16354 zip code area.
Titusville and the 16354 zip code are located in Crawford County, which has an EPA assigned Radon Zone of 2. A radon zone of 2 predicts an average indoor radon screening level between 2 and 4 pCi/L. The EPA recommends testing every home regardless of zone classification.
